Inhibitory capacity of filtrates from trichoderma inhamatum and caiophora andina over phytopathogens of theobroma cacao

Spanish title: Capacidad inhibitoria de filtrados de Trichoderma inhamatum y Caiophora andina sobre fitopatógenos de Theobroma cacao. Se trabajó con extractos de filtrados de cultivos de Trichoderma inhamatum y extractos hidro-etanólicos de Caiophora andina sobre cepas patógenas de cacao Theobroma cacao. Los porcentajes de inhibición obtenidos luego de la determinación del crecimiento hifal in vitro bajo el efecto del filtrado fúngico de cepa Trichoderma inhamatum Bol 12-QD fueron: para Moniliophthora spp. 11 % (en el día 4), para Colletotrichum spp. 20 % (día 11) y para Phytophthora spp., 46 % (día 9). Mientras que, los porcentajes de inhibición del crecimiento bajo el efecto de los extractos hidroetanólicos vegetales, extracto 1 (tallo-hojas) y extracto 2 (flores) fueron: para el patógeno Moniliophthora spp. 36% y 27 % respectivamente (a los 4 días), para Colletotrichum spp. 20 y 24 % respectivamente (a los 7 días) y finalmente para Phytophthora spp. 31% y 38 % respectivamente (ambos al día 9). Por ende, se propone ambos filtrados para el control de hongos fitopatógenos en Theobroma cacao.
The filtrates of cultures of Trichoderma inhamatum and hydroethanolic extracts of Caiphora andina were assayed in vitro over pathogen strains of Theobroma cacao (cacao). The inhibition percentage after determination of the hifal growing in vitro were: for Trichoderma inhamatum Bol 12-QD, 11% in Moniliophthora spp (fourth day); 20% in Colletotrichum spp. (eleventh day); 46% in Phytophthora spp. (ninth day). The inhibition percentage for hydroethanolic extracts of Caiophora andina were: for the stem-leaves extract, 36% in Moniliophthora spp. (fourth day), for the flowers extract, 27% in Moniliophthora spp. (fourth day), for the stem-leaves extract, 20% in Colletotrichum spp. (seventh day), for the flowers extract, 24% in Colletotrichum spp (seventh day), for the stem-leaves extract, 31% in Phytophthora spp. (ninth day), for the flowers extract, 38% in Phytophthora spp. (ninth day). These results indicate that these filtrates are appropriate for the control of growing of phytopathogen fungi in Theobroma cacao.
